Heads up, plugin folks: the Quillbase API had a nasty N+1 on nested author lookups. We fixed it with a batching resolver, so your plugins should stop hammering the database. If you ship your own resolvers, enable batching too. The loader settings we run in production are shown below.

settings of tagef-bawif:
DRUIX_HOST=druix.zemvarlabs.internal
DRUIX_PORT=8000

Q: Why does the extract-strings script fail on reviewer machines?

A: The Lexifern extraction script needs the locale cache warmed before its first run, which CI does automatically but your laptop doesn't. Run the warmup task once and retry. If the cache vault prompts you, supply the recovery passphrase listed below.

recovery phrase for bawep-kawef: oliath-casdor

# Env config for the Lattermill report builder.
# Note on sorting: the builder uses a stable merge sort when ordering report rows,
# so ties preserve the order emitted by the query layer. Do not "fix" apparent
# duplicates by adding a secondary sort in templates; set it in the dataset spec
# instead, or exports and on-screen previews will diverge. The STABLE_SORT_STRICT
# flag below must stay true in all environments. The signing secret used to
# stamp generated reports is set on the next line.

sealed setting: VAULT_KEY20=69e2a0b23f1a79fbf692

Subject: Partner SFTP drop — new owner

Hi,

As you review the pending changes to the Harborline ingest scripts, note that ownership of the partner SFTP drop is changing at the end of the month. This includes key rotation, the nightly pull job, and the quarantine folder for malformed files. Review comments on the retry logic should still go through the normal PR flow, but questions about drop-folder conventions or partner onboarding now go to the new owner. The incoming owner is listed below.

signatory, tagaf-bahaf: Praael Fenmir Rusok